General asymmetric hydrogenation of alpha-branched aromatic ketones catalyzed by TolBINAP/DMAPEN-ruthenium(II) complex.

Noriyoshi Arai1, Hirohito Ooka, Keita Azuma, Toshio Yabuuchi, Nobuhito Kurono, Tsutomu Inoue, Takeshi Ohkuma.   

Abstract

[reaction: see text] A catalyst system consisting of RuCl2[(S)-tolbinap][(R)-dmapen] and t-C4H9OK in 2-propanol effects asymmetric hydrogenation of arylglyoxal dialkylacetals to give the alpha-hydroxy acetals in up to 98% ee. Hydrogenation of racemic alpha-amidopropiophenones under dynamic kinetic resolution predominantly gives the syn alcohols in up to 99% ee and >98% de, while the reaction of racemic bezoin methyl ether gives the anti alcohols in excellent stereoselectivity.
